18.

Farm Re-lettings: Higher Artiscombe Farm, Gulworthy and Little Stone Farm, South Molton

(An Item to be considered by the Committee in accordance with the Cabinet Procedure Rules and Regulation 5 of the Local Authorities (Executive Arrangements) Meetings and Access to Information) (England) Regulations 2012, no representations having been received to such consideration taking place under Regulation 5(5) thereof.)

 

To interview shortlisted applicants for these vacant holdings (timetable and supporting documents circulated separately).

Decision:

(a)  Higher Artiscombe Farm, Gulworthy

 

RESOLVED that the tenancy of Higher Artiscombe Farm, Gulworthy be offered to Mr JW on the subject to contract terms and conditions proposed and in the event that Mr JW does not take up the offer of tenancy the farm can be offered in the alternative to Mr SE as runner up.

 

(b)  Little Stone Farm, South Molton

 

RESOLVED that the tenancy of Little Stone Farm, South Molton be offered to Mrs JRW on the subject to contract terms and conditions proposed and in the event that Mrs JRW does not take up the offer of tenancy the farm can be offered in the alternative to Mr CF as runner up.
